At the end of the first day of the NHL’s 2023 free agency season on Saturday, the Toronto Maple Leafs had no shortage of critics who saw an exodus of veteran talent, and not very much coming back in return. However, as of Sunday afternoon, the critics weren’t nearly as loud, as the Leafs went out and signed winger Tyler Bertuzzi – one of the very best unrestricted free agents on the open market – to a one-year, $5.5-million contract.
Suddenly, with Bertuzzi’s arrival, the departure of gritty winger Michael Bunting doesn’t sting nearly as much. Bertuzzi is only a couple years removed from scoring 30 goals in 68 games, and although his stint with the Boston Bruins was a short one last season, he showed some jam in the playoffs, with five goals and 10 points in seven games. He can go about his business this season, and if he’s as productive as he’s been in the past, Toronto can figure out a way to sign him for the long term. (This is especially possible if the Leafs have to give up on William Nylander as a long-term solution.)

Now that Bertuzzi is in Blue and White, the Buds have one of the league’s very best lines – Bertuzzi, Auston Matthews and Mitch Marner – and the trickle-down effect on the roster means Toronto’s second line will almost certainly consist of Nylander, John Tavares and rookie Matthew Knies. That would leave a third line of winger Calle Jarnkroc, David Kampf and Nick Robertson, and a fourth line of Sam Lafferty, Pontus Holmberg and new signee Ryan Reaves. Not too shabby at all – and who knows, depending on their health status during the season, the Leaf and GM Brad Treliving can go out near the trade deadline and add depth on defense.
All this is to say that, despite the angst and anger of the first day of free agency, the Leafs are better than many, if not most teams in the Atlantic Division. There is no good reason why they cannot secure home-ice advantage in the playoffs. There’s no question there will be tweaks to the lineup – show me a team that isn’t tweaking, and I’ll show you a team that isn’t trying – but Treliving took a difficult salary cap situation and made Toronto a more difficult team to play against.
The Leafs’ next move is likely to be a buyout or trade involving goalie Matt Murray, a veteran who simply doesn’t have the staying power, health-wise, to be leaned on as a key contributor. As we’ve said in this space before, Toronto will be going with a netminding tandem of starter Ilya Samsonov and youngster Joseph Woll, and the savings associated with the dumping of Murray’s contract will provide vital cap space to (a) sign Samsonov to a new contract; and (b) give the Buds a little bit of breathing space under the cap.

The Leafs’ addition of Bertuzzi – as well as veteran defenseman John Klingberg, who signed a one-year, $4-million contract Saturday – provides a boost to the team on offense. And when the salary cap rises meaningfully at the end of next season, Treliving will have the space to extend Bertuzzi or go in another direction if things don’t work out. The Bertuzzi signing is a low-risk, high-reward gamble, but it takes him away from the division-rival Boston Bruins, and that’s a win in and of itself.
The moral of the story for Leafs fans Sunday? Patience, grasshopper. Patience. Give Treliving some credit – not only for landing Bertuzzi but for walking away from UFA veterans Justin Holl and Alex Kerfoot, which is addition by subtraction. This Toronto team will look and feel notably different in 2023-24, and the way the Buds were smoked by Florida in the second round of this spring’s Stanley Cup playoffs, that’s clearly a good thing.
